Graham Gillies
M.Sc.PT, CAFCI, FCAMPT, MCISc(MT), CGIMS

Graham is a physiotherapist and the clinic manager at Sun City Physiotherapy in Winfield. Before moving to the Okanagan, Graham worked for almost two years overseas as senior therapist at the Fawzia Sultan Rehabilitation Institute in Kuwait City. In Kuwait, Graham was also the Men's National Tennis Team therapist.

Before working in the Middle East, Graham spent two years at one of the largest and busiest private practice sports clinics in Toronto where he also worked with Canada's National Men's Tennis Team. Graham was born in Windermere, British Columbia and completed his Undergraduate Degree in Human Kinetics at the University of British Columbia. He then graduated from the University of Toronto in the Faculty of Medicine's School of Rehabilitation Sciences where he received his Masters of Science in Physical Therapy. Graham recently went on to get a second Masters degree from the University of Western Ontario, obtaining his Masters in Clinical Science in Manipulative Therapy. Graham is a fellow of the Canadian Academy of Manipulative Therapy and a certified Gunn IMS (Intramuscular Stimulation) and Acupuncture practitioner. He specializes in the treatment of sports injuries as well as neuromuscular dysfunction and chronic spinal pain.

During university Graham was a double sport Varsity athlete in both volleyball and football and he continues to stay active in his leisure time.
